Start off by getting one right. You will learn a lot from that process, which will save you from making the same mistakes again on future sites. Once you truly know what you're doing, it's much easier to repeat. I've been in this industry a long time and have seen it done both ways. Believe me, the folks who start with one and make that a success do much better than the ones who try multiples at once.
